A beautifully illustrated site using CSS3 keyframes and transitions to provide subtle animation.

This is a pretty interesting site design. Powered by illustrations, most of the interactive elements are made up of pieces of the illustration. The animated duck on the swing gives the page a good focus to move on to the navigation. It’s definitely unconventional, but I think it works for the purpose of keeping things interesting. I also like how there are sections of the illustration that link to deeper pages on the site, like the newspaper going to news. Clever.
